Whiskey Sour Recipe
Description
The cocktail starts by shaking bourbon, plum syrup, lemon juice, fresh ginger juice, and egg white without ice to emulsify and build froth. After this, ice is added and the mixture is shaken again to chill. Straining over a single large ice cube in a rocks glass ensures slow dilution. The addition of candied ginger and a plum slice garnish complements the drink's fruity and spicy notes while adding a decorative touch.
The fresh ginger juice adds a subtle warmth and zing that contrasts with the sour brightness of lemon and the sweet plum syrup. The egg white contributes a creamy mouthfeel and appealing foam atop the cocktail. Using a higher proof bourbon can intensify the depth of flavor.
This whiskey sour variant is suitable for those seeking a nuanced twist on the classic sour, with an added dimension from the plum syrup and ginger. It works well as a refreshing aperitif or evening cocktail.
Fresh ginger juice can be prepared by grating fresh ginger over a strainer and pressing it to extract juice, though pre-bottled ginger juice is an acceptable shortcut.
Ingredients
- 1 1/2 ounces bourbon I like to use a slightly overproof bourbon in this
- 3/4 ounce plum syrup
- 3/4 ounce lemon juice fresh
- 1/4 ounce ginger fresh juice
- 1 egg white
- plum sliced, fresh
- candied ginger
Instructions
- Shake all ingredients together without ice, in order to emulsify the egg white.
- Add ice to the shaking tin and shake again to chill the drink. Strain over a large ice cube in a rocks glass. Garnish with candied ginger and plum.
Notes
- Use about 1/4 ounce of fresh ginger juice per drink for balanced spice.
- Fresh ginger juice can be extracted by grating ginger over a strainer and pressing with a spatula to collect juice.
- Store-bought ginger juice is a convenient alternative if fresh ginger is not available.
